Atlanta Braves at Minnesota Twins (2026-08-18). Tyler Mahle vs Zebby Matthews at Target Field.
Tyler Mahle enters with a 4-9 record, pitching to a 4.64 ERA and a 1.32 WHIP across 106.2 innings. He maintains an 8.86 K/9, a 3.29 BB/9, and a 1.27 HR/9, with his recent performance trending downward. In his previous three outings, Mahle delivered lines of 6.0 innings with 1 earned run, 7 strikeouts, and 0 walks; 6.0 innings with 0 earned runs, 9 strikeouts, and 2 walks; and 5.2 innings with 5 earned runs, 9 strikeouts, and 2 walks. Zebby Matthews holds a 1.35 WHIP across 91.0 innings of work this season. He owns a 6-8 record with a 5.34 ERA, striking out 7.62 batters per nine innings while issuing 2.97 walks and 1.78 home runs per nine frames amid a downward trend. His last three appearances produced 5.0 innings with 4 earned runs, 4 strikeouts, and 2 walks; 5.0 innings with 3 earned runs, 4 strikeouts, and 2 walks; and 5.0 innings with 3 earned runs, 10 strikeouts, and 2 walks.
The Atlanta offense has generated 601 runs with a .728 OPS and a .247 batting average, while their pitching staff holds a 3.64 ERA and a 1.24 WHIP alongside a 4-6 record over their last 10 games. The Minnesota offense has scored 582 runs supported by a .725 OPS and a .245 batting average, paired with a team pitching ERA of 4.65 and a 1.38 WHIP as they also sit at 4-6 across their past 10 contests.
